Exclusive Banksy Auction to Be Held in New York

London’s Forum Auctions is taking 40 works by British street artist Banksy to New York. The exact time of the auction is not announced yet. New Yorkers have a particularly strong affinity with the artist following his 31 day “Better out than in” residency in the Big Apple during 2010, Artdaily.com reported.  The works on offer provide a solid cross section of his commercially produced prints from the earliest Rude Copper (2002) to his most recent open edition Box Set, available for purchase only from the ‘gift shop’ of his Walled Off Hotel project in Jerusalem (opened 2017).

Forum Auctions has become a leading auction house for Banksy editions having sold over 100 examples over the past 12 months for a total of $2 million. All works in the sale are offered with certificates from the artist’s authenticating body, Pest Control Office.

Banksy is an anonymous England-based graffiti artist, political activist and film director of unverified identity. His satirical street art and subversive epigrams combine dark humor with graffiti executed in a distinctive stenciling technique.
